This came back from a clinic in Bilbao which may be of use. I am emailing BF again today to try and further clarify the situation. It may be that ferry travel has a different set of rules due to the length of trip, Good to see Spain remained amber!

recepcion@clinicaindautxu.com

Hours are Monday to Friday from 07:30 to 19:00 and Saturdays from 08:00 to 13:30 without prior appointment.

Sundays, holidays, after hours and urgent, by appointment request. € 20 supplement.

ANTIGENS. Nasopharynx, oropharynx and saliva results in 60 minutes. Amount € 40.

If you are interested in making an appointment, you have to send us your name, 2 surnames, date and country of birth, ID, NIE and / or passport (the latter is mandatory to travel), full address (street, postal code and town) , phone and email.

IMPORTANT TO SPECIFY DAY, APPROXIMATE TIME AND TEST TO BE PERFORMED.

At the time of the test, they are given a paper with some keys, to be able to download it on the web.

THE RESULT COMES BY DEFAULT IN SPANISH AND ENGLISH

Just an update! We arrived in Bilbao for the antigen test and took the van into the centre of town. Be warned there is no parking available for a large van, but car sized spaces were seen.
We parked in the Autocaravaning Kobetamendi site (15€) that overlooks Bilbao, but get there early as the site was full by 4pm and queues formed outside!
The reception called a taxi for us, less than 10€ each way (and our dog had to be in a carrier), but there is also a regular bus that goes into the city from the site, and dogs must be in a carrier.
The clinic was really efficient, no english spoken by the reception but the testers do speak english, and our results were ready an hour later.
Boarding the ferry no problem, but a 5 hour delay gave worries that our test 48 hour validity would run out. Arrived 2330 into Portsmouth with 30 mins to spare!
Make sure that you have copies of your locator form to hand, otherwise no issues arriving in the UK.
